Angular testing course github. This course repository is updated to Angular v19.

Angular testing course github More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ects. testing angular. This was done to highlight testing services with dependencies. Examples of testing AngularJS with dom-testing-library - GitHub - burdell/angularjs-testing: Examples of testing AngularJS with dom-testing-library. For example, here is how you switch to a new node version using nave Course repository for AngularJS with Karma + Jasmine - porfidev/course-angularjs-testing This repository contains the code of the course Angular Router In Depth. Repository with examples and comments written during the 'Angular Testing Course' course, at Angular University. io Nx workspace. It was a great experience, especially the fact that sharing the slides is as simple as sharing a URL. Test repository for coursera course on AngularJS. master Create a new workspace for developing libraries. This repository currently contains the code for the Firebase & AngularFire In Depth. com/joshuamorony/refresh-app. Test Driven Development (TDD) is a programming practice that instructs developers Of course specs that test the test helpers belong in the test folder, next to their corresponding helper files. Check out my GitHub repo 馃殌 for solutions to IBM Full Stack Software Developer Professional Certificate practice questions and quizzes, and a summary of program lessons. At a command prompt, type node -v to ensure you have version 14. This is simply a repository of just some sample test done through Mosh Hamedani's Testing Angular 4 (previously Angular 2) Apps with Jasmine course on Udemy. Shallow component tests To repeat what was stated earlier, shallow tests focus on one component and ignore any subcomponents that may exist. Skip to content. Reload to refresh your session. The For taking the course we recommend installing Node 18 Long Term Support Edition (LTE). . - Normandy72/Testing-With-Jasmine Coursera AngularJS course test repository. Example Angular applications used in the book; Features demonstrated by the examples; In this guide, we will explore the different aspects of testing Angular applications by looking at two examples. This project was generated with Angular CLI. - Jaguar1/conFusion Angular Testing Course If you are looking for the Angular Testing Course , the repo with the full code can be found here: Serverless Angular with Firebase Course Hi All, I'm Dinanath Jayaswal, Senior UI/Web Developer and Adobe Certified Expert Professional, I wanna welcome you to Angular Unit Testing with Jasmine and Karma. Instant dev environments Test repo for angularjs course in coursera. GitHub is where people build software. Demo Project for the Angular Academy Workshop. Find and fix vulnerabilities Testing AngularJS Controllers. Set up continuous integration link One of the best ways to keep your project bug-free is through a test suite, but it's easy to forget to run tests all the time. 0+. Testing Library has 31 repositories available. This course discusses automated testing Testing Angular Applications is an example-rich, hands-on guide that gives you the real-world techniques you need to thoroughly test all parts of your Angular applications. app. coursera angularjs test. Ensure you have node installed. We have a long history of World Firsts Visit www. Angular possibilites testing for development, staging and production. Stripe Payments In Practice This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. This repository contains the code of the Angular Testing Course. Contribute to NicolaPrevedello/AngularJS-course development by creating an account on GitHub. fixture. For the 2021 edition of the course Refer to this GitHub repo Find and fix vulnerabilities Codespaces. First clone or download as a Zip file using the green "Clone Or Download" button on the top right of the document. Here is a Spring Boot Learning Path and Roadmap to help you learn more about Spring Boot. Contribute to t-palmer/angular-unit-testing development by creating an account on GitHub. Run npm run api for a dev only api server. Then change directory to the folder 01-getting-started-with-angular2, where you will find a small node project with a package. Contribute to ossygomez/coursera-angularjs development by creating an account on GitHub. In this course, End-to-end Angular Testing with Cypress, you'll learn how to use Cypress to test your Angular applications. Automate any workflow Test repo for AngularJS course. Find and fix vulnerabilities Test repo for coursera. Contribute to juristr/angular-testing-recipes development by creating an account on GitHub. In this course/tutorial, will take you from the basics/ground and gives you a solid foundation to write automated tests for your Angular Saved searches Use saved searches to filter your results more quickly 1. ts and save. First, you'll see how to set up a development environment and add Cypress to an existing Angular project using Angular CLI. Couse by Mosh Hamedani. Contribute to DRaj-23/angularjs-coursera development by creating an account on GitHub. We will cover how to test several types of typical Angular components, such as for example presentational components and smart or container components, and we will learn how to mock Angular Observable-based services. Contribute to JOBA1122/coursera_course_angular development by creating an account on GitHub. The instructor of this course is Mosh (Moshfegh) Hamedani, a software engineer. Simple testing patterns for Angular version 2+. To see this in action, make a small change to app. dev/tools/cli To use this command, you need to first add a package that implements end-to-end testing capabilities. Find and fix vulnerabilities Codespaces. For example, to run the au-input module, we can do the AngularJS Test This is my first attempt to learn AngularJS. This repository contains the code of the Angular Testing Course Plan and track work Code Review. By default, the production build optimizes your application for performance and speed. Contribute to fevaldez/angularjs-test development by creating an account on GitHub. This sample will use the Angular 6/Nrwl. BTW, you can find decent unit testing styleguide for Angular in corresponding repository nearby. Testing Angular is often mentioned here for good reason, it's great. Sign in Product Angular lets you start small on a well-lit path and supports you as your team and apps grow. Angular Academy is a world-class hands-on instructor-led Angular training provider. I've got a reasonably advanced public codebase available that was developed using this strategy: https://github. I saw this course on pluralsight when I was angular. angularjs course. Host and manage packages Security Using Angular Tour of Heroes, here is demonstration of testing in Angular. Dec 13, 2024 路 GitHub community articles Repositories. Contribute to angular/angular development by creating an account on GitHub. detectChanges() inject() - A proxy for Angular TestBed. js). Meanwhile, the ng test command is watching for changes. Instant dev environments Mar 28, 2022 路 Automated tests play a vital role in modern software development. Learning objectives. Apr 30, 2021 路 This button displays the currently selected search type. - Write robust unit and integration tests to ensure application reliability. - Normandy72/Testing-Components Angular Router In Depth (Video Course). TypeScript 301. Instant dev environments This repository contains the code of the Angular Core Deep Dive. The Angular team published experimental support for Jest with Angular 16, but it took me until Angular 17 to take it for a ride. About. Topics Trending Angular Testing Course - A complete guide to Angular Unit Testing and E2E Testing. Welcome to the world of Test-Driven Development (TDD) An ongoing curated list of frameworks, books, articles, talks, screencasts, recordings, libraries, learning tutorials and resources about test-driven-development. This course repository is updated to Angular v12, and there is a package-lock. This course repository is updated to Angular v14, and there is a package-lock. If you are looking for the Angular Testing Course, the repo with the full code can be found here: Serverless Angular with Firebase Course If you are looking for the Serverless Angular with Firebase Course , the repo with the full code can be found here: Test repo for AngularJS course in coursera. NPM 5 or above has the big advantage that if you use it you will be installing the exact same dependencies than I installed in my machine, so you wont run into issues caused by Feb 15, 2024 路 Toggle navigation. The Nx workspace is an enhanced environment that extends some of the capabilities of the default Angular 6 workspace Navigation Menu Toggle navigation. angularacademy. Explore > 53 engaging videos (≈ 7 hours in total), all focused on Angular testing. In this course, learn how Code samples for Angular Unit Testing training. You find the result in the Angular 17 folder. You switched accounts on another tab or window. This should take a couple of Coursera AngularJs testing environment for my online course. Using Figma alongside Angular, not just as a visual aid, but also as a CSS code provider; Resource that comes alongside the course: · GitHub repository with all codes divided by modules; · GitBook with extra explanations; Some test and learning based on Coursera "Single Page Web Applications with AngularJS" course - GitHub - lilloraffa/angularjs-test: Some test and learning based on Coursera "Single P Testing AngularJS Components. Covers testing of standalone Angular API. Testing Javascript with Jasmine. This course repository is updated to Angular 19: You can find the starting point of the course in the 1-start branch. runInInjectionContext() Setting inputs directly on a pipe using setInput or props is not possible. Contribute to Hakan-tarim/Angular-coursera-test development by creating an account on GitHub. Topics Trending Angular Testing Course - A complete guide to Angular Unit Testing and E2E Testing This repository contains the code of the Angular Testing Course. This course repository is updated to Angular v19. json file available, for avoiding semantic versioning installation issues. Contribute to n1h1lu5/pluralsight-angularjs-testing development by creating an account on GitHub. - Normandy72/Testing-Controllers Testing AngularJS Directives. Contribute to luisfont/coursera-test development by creating an account on GitHub. This course repository is updated to Angular v13, and there is a package-lock. angular. Feel free to give it a 猸愶笍 and fork for inspiration or your own projects. Oct 8, 2024 路 Tutorial Angular Material 18. Write better code with AI Security. Seems quite up to date. This is the repository for the LinkedIn Learning course Angular: Testing and Debugging. - Normandy72/Testing-Directives If you're interested in exploring earlier versions and syntax of Angular, take a look at our “Angular - The Complete Guide for Angular 16/17” course. - bcompto/Angular-Testing-Examples-Jasmine-Karma You want to write maintainable tests for your Angular components. This course repository is updated to Angular v19, and there is a package-lock. NPM 5 or above has the big advantage that if you use it you will be installing the exact same dependencies than I installed in my machine, so you wont run into issues caused by semantic versioning updates. ©2023 GitHub 涓枃绀惧尯 璁哄潧 Angular Testing Course - A complete guide to Angular Unit Testing and E2E Testing. Run npm run lint to fix or report lint failures. To easily switch between node versions on your machine, we recommend using a node virtual environment tool such as nave or nvm-windows, depending on your operating system. Tutorial Visit the Getting Started Guide for a step-by-step tutorial on adding component testing to any project and how to write your first tests. When expanded it provides a list of search options that will switch the search inputs to match the current selection. Run npm test to execute the unit tests via Karma. Contribute to Oswaldoj/coursera-angularjs-test development by creating an account on GitHub. In this course/tutorial, will take you from the basics/ground and gives you a solid foundation to write automated tests for your Angular apps. The components and content were created and taught by him. Contribute to paolopci/angular-material-course development by creating an account on GitHub. json at master · angular-university/angular This repository contains the code of the Angular Testing Course. Tour of Heroes included. Deliver web apps with confidence 馃殌. setParamMap (params?: GitHub community articles Repositories. Sign in Product Run npm start for a dev server. Contribute to AngeloCinaWD/angular-testing-course development by creating an account on GitHub. Contribute to Rashad-Harun/coursera-test-angularJs development by creating an account on GitHub. Topics covered include Isolated Unit Testing, Integration Testing, Jasmine TestBed, and Jasmine Mocks - Matt-Cam/AngularTestingPresentation Test repository for AngularJS course. Contribute to Muni0106/Coursera-AngularJS development by creating an account on GitHub. It's probably not perfect: the Angular team hasn't published a tutorial yet (or I didn't find it), so much of my code is guesswork. Please refer to the documentation to learn about its main commands and Find and fix vulnerabilities Codespaces. Click on a test row to re-run just that test or click on a description to re-run the tests in the selected test group ("test suite"). Contribute to Jayiitb/AngularJS development by creating an account on GitHub. data?: Data; paramMap?: ParamMap; initialData?: Data; initialSnapshot?: ActivatedRouteSnapshotStub; initialParams?: Params; // ReplaySubject is not compatible with snapshot testing since it produces a window timestamp. Loved by millions Join the millions of developers all over the world building with Angular in a thriving and friendly community. - angular-testing/README. Contribute to jerrylauky/angularjs-testing development by creating an account on GitHub. As a part of this goal, you want your tests to avoid including implementation details of your components and rather focus on making your tests give you the confidence for which they are intended. Contribute to lfyan/AngularJS-course development by creating an account on GitHub. It's a simple course listing web app that allows a user to sort and filter courses based on a number of criteria. Manage code changes To use this command, you need to first add a package that implements end-to-end testing capabilities. To use this command, you need to first add a package that implements end-to-end testing capabilities. 5 components after this course will keep you up to date. AngularJS Testing My first attempt at using an HTML5 presentation framework (bespoke. ca for our list of Angular related courses: Angular Fundamentals; Advanced Angular; Testing Angular; RxJS Workshop; Angular Architecture; Advanced Coursera Course Test. Sign in This repository contains the code of the Angular Material In Depth video course. You can find those files in this github repo The Angular CLI is a command-line interface tool that you use to initialize, develop, scaffold, and maintain Angular applications directly from a command shell. You signed out in another tab or window. 9 澶╁墠 Cypress Component Testing supports Angular 17. Contribute to progmaker85/coursera-angularjs-test development by creating an account on GitHub. The test output is displayed in the browser using Karma Jasmine HTML Reporter. Sign in Product Hi All, I'm Dinanath Jayaswal, Senior UI/Web Developer and Adobe Certified Expert Professional, I wanna welcome you to Angular Unit Testing with Jasmine and Karma. Contribute to peniasuki/coursera-angularjs development by creating an account on GitHub. Testing Angular (previously Angular 2) Apps with Jasmine is a program provided by Udemy to give you a foundation to write automated tests for Angular applications. Using Angular Material; 4. The course is expertly crafted by a Google Developer Expert in Angular and a Microsoft MVP in Developer Technologies. A command-line tool that scaffolds Angular projects with Jest as the default testing framework. What is Angular Academy ? Angular Academy offers a wide range of Angular related courses (TypeScript, RxJS, Signals, NgRx, Architecture, Unit Testing, Material Design, PWA, Performance, ), in the form of intensive training for professional web developers, available as public classes or as corporate training. inject() flushEffects() - A proxy for Angular TestBed. Follow their code on GitHub.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ects. md at master · dragorwyin/angular-testing Find and fix vulnerabilities Codespaces. You’ll start with an introduction to Angular, TypeScript, testing fundamentals, and the testing frameworks and tools used in the book and begin writing your first tests. Jan 23, 2025 路 8. js. 0 or higher before proceeding. 2. Test repo for course. Aug 8, 2022 路 Helpers and examples for unit testing on Angular applications and libraries. By the end of this course, you’ll be able to: - Set up Angular testing tools, including Jasmine and Karma, for comprehensive test case development. Contribute to pauloteixeirajr/angular-testing development by creating an account on GitHub. Also notice the lack of the TestBed class from the core angular testing library. This repository is made of several separate npm modules, that are installable separately. If you are looking for the Angular Testing Course, the repo with the full code can be found here: Github repo for this course. 馃殌 Angular Crash Course for Beginners 馃殌. Coursera course "Single Page Web Applications with AngularJS" by Yaakov Chaikin. 15. Errors caused by missing dependencies, undefined variables, or poorly formatted data can cause your web application to stop working. Testing Module: The testing portion of the course uses two files which weren't created in the course: UserData. Sign in AngularJS SAP course. These are links to luv2code courses on Udemy. Creating Angular components; 3. More than 94 million people use GitHub to discover, fork, and contribute to over 330 million projects. Contribute to ali-bouali/angular-crash-course development by creating an account on GitHub. For example, here is how you switch to a You signed in with another tab or window. The following are detailed instructions for installing the code so you can code along with the course. Contribute to tutsplus/angularjs-for-test-driven-development development by creating an account on GitHub. This will compile your project and store the build artifacts in the dist/ directory. Contribute to aayushiporwal07/coursera-angularjs development by creating an account on GitHub. Designed for newbies in Angular Testing. Testing Angular (previously Angular 2) Apps with Jasmine. Contribute to EvangelosTsakanikas/angular-testing-course development by creating an account on GitHub. detectChanges() - A proxy for Angular TestBed. I use this project to test different concepts of unit testing the Angular applications. For taking the course we recommend installing Node 16. Checking out Pluralsight's course on Angular 1. Testing of AngularJS. Contribute to GWSafar/angular-router-course-1 development by creating an account on GitHub. js and UserResource. This course is updated to Angular 13: You can find the starting point of the course in the 1-start branch. Aug 22, 2021 路 Example applications. flushEffects() runInInjectionContext() - A proxy for Angular TestBed. Contribute to igorbakhtin/angularjs-test development by creating an account on GitHub. Exercises for Coursera AngularJS course. json. Contribute to gabdlr/angular-testing-course development by creating an account on GitHub. Test repo for coursera course. Contribute to larzon/coursera-test-angularjs development by creating an account on GitHub. Further help To get more help on the Angular CLI use ng help or go check out the Angular CLI Overview and Command Reference page. Instant dev environments This video course, complete with a running Github repository is a complete step–by–step guide to Angular Testing in general. component. Effortlessly replace Jasmine and Karma, configure Jest for Angular, and automate the setup process for efficient testing. Navigation Menu Toggle navigation The home for all testing-library projects. We are going to take a small sample application that is already completed, but that has no tests yet. Lifetime access to all videos in the course & all course updates Angular Testing Course - A complete guide to Angular Unit Testing and E2E Testing - angular-testing-course/tsconfig. Unit testing Angular components; 2. Find and fix vulnerabilities Actions. Navigation Menu Toggle navigation. The 10-course program has ample instructional content and hands-on exercises. The angularJs course. Run npm run release to create a new release with semantic versions and a change file Contribute to AngeloCinaWD/angular-testing-course development by creating an account on GitHub. You can purchase the courses to further your studies. The tests run again, the browser refreshes, and the new test results appear. We leave out the TestBed here to show that the isolated test is focused on the component and does not include DOM testing. The full course is available from LinkedIn Learning. This repository contains the code of the Angular Testing Course. Installation To get up and running with Cypress Component Testing in Angular, install Cypress into your project: Test Coursera repo. Testing Angular Applications is an example-rich, hands-on guide that gives you the real-world techniques you need to thoroughly test all parts of your Angular applications. x. // export for convenience. This repository contains the code of the course Angular SSR In Depth (formerly Angular Universal). lkvl stk urex bwma didtczsf akeqt qkun ibhluz azuoawhj boseyowv bupru bodtp cumj prffui wjoz